Einfärbung

Da wir das Ergebnis des k-Means-Algorithmus verwenden wollen, um das Originalbild zu komprimieren, sollten die Pixel der einzelnen Cluster entsprechend geeignet eingefärbt werden. Hierzu wählen wir folgende Strategie:

Alle Pixel eines Clusters werden in derselben Farbe dargestellt. Nämlich in der Farbe, die sich als Mittelwert aus den Farben der Pixel des Clusters im Originalbild ergibt.

Es wird also eine spezifische Farbpalette unter Berücksichtigung des Ergebnisses der Clusteranalyse erstellt. Wie die Farbpalette bestimmt werden kann, zeigt das folgende Beispiel.

Beispiel
Es wird eine Bildsegmentierung unter Verwendung von vier Clustern durchgeführt. Alle Pixel eines Clusters werden anschließend in einer geeigneten Farbe dargestellt.
Aufgabe

Mache dich mit dem Quellcode des Beispiels zuvor vertraut. Verändere die Anzahl der Cluster und beobachte das Ergebnis. Hinweis: Je mehr Cluster gewählt werden, desto größer ist die Rechenzeit bei der Durchführung des k-Means-Algorithmus.

Quiz
Hast du dich mit der Aufgabe beschäftigt? Stimmen deine Beobachtungen mit deinen Erwartungen überein?
ja
nein
Kompressionsrate